Paris at Dawn

(Paris à l'aube)

"Like when you wake up at the end of winter, and the air smells of spring…"

April 23, 2013. The French Senate is holding a historic vote on same-sex marriage. Jack and François return home to their Parisian apartment to find a wall has been torn down by their neighbors, Marine and Sam. As Paris floods with riots outside, the only option for the two couples is to spend the day together. Paris at Dawn is the story of their journey to coexistence, love, and acceptance of each other and themselves.
